  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 2,831 ✭✭✭Healio


    To an extent, it is not even an age thing. They just need to verify who you are; i.e. no different to a bank account.

    Send off a copy of either your Garda or Passport and something with your address on it. Also keep a digital copy of these (on your pc/or if you are that way inclined a USB stick), so its easy to access/send on to others; provided you are over 18 :pac:.
